The last incarnation of Vishnu who is expected to appear at the end of Kali Yuga, the time period in which we currently exist, to rid the world of the oppression of its unrighteous rulers
AnswerClick to flip back
A
Kalki
💡 Explanation:
Kalki is the prophesied final avatar of Vishnu in Hinduism, expected to appear at the end of Kali Yuga (the current age) to end unrighteousness and restart a new cycle of time. Matsya and Varaha were earlier avatars, while Balarama is sometimes counted as an avatar but is not the final one.
